快马平台一键生成ER图与SQL:三步完成数据库设计原型

张开发
2026/4/3 11:20:51 15 分钟阅读
快马平台一键生成ER图与SQL:三步完成数据库设计原型
最近在做一个电商后台系统的数据库设计需要快速验证数据模型是否合理。传统画ER图工具要么太复杂要么无法直接生成可执行的SQL代码。尝试了InsCode(快马)平台后发现它完美解决了从设计到落地的全流程问题。这里分享下我的使用体验自然语言转ER图在平台输入框简单描述需求需要电商系统的ER图包含用户、商品、订单、购物车四个核心实体。AI在10秒内就生成了规范的ER图代码自动识别出用户与订单的一对多关系订单与商品的多对多关系通过订单明细表实现用户与购物车的一对一关系 最惊喜的是连用户最近浏览记录这种我没明确提到的关联实体也自动补充了。一键生成SQL点击导出SQL按钮立即得到完整的建表语句所有字段都带注释自动添加了外键约束为常用查询字段创建了索引 比如订单表的status字段直接生成了ENUM类型避免后续出现无效状态值。配套文档与代码系统还附赠了两份实用产出数据字典文档解释每个字段的业务含义Node.js项目骨架包含配置好的Sequelize模型文件 省去了手动创建models目录和编写字段映射的时间。实时调整优化发现商品分类需要三级结构时直接在AI对话框追加需求商品分类需要支持三级层级父分类ID自关联。ER图和SQL都立即同步更新关联关系自动保持正确。整个过程中最实用的三个功能点可视化编辑鼠标拖动就能调整实体位置语法检查关系配置错误时会实时提示版本对比每次修改都能查看差异对于需要快速验证模型的场景这个工作流比传统方式快至少5倍。以往要经历画图工具设计 - 手动写SQL - 建表测试 - 发现错误 - 重新修改的循环。现在所有步骤在平台里一站式完成关键是可以直接部署测试点击部署按钮后系统自动创建MySQL数据库实例执行生成的建表SQL启动Node.js服务提供可访问的API测试地址实测从零开始到获得可运行的API服务全程不超过15分钟。对于敏捷开发中的快速原型验证特别有用建议数据库设计阶段都先用这个工具跑通核心模型再进入详细开发。平台对新手也很友好不需要掌握专业的ER图语法用日常语言描述就能获得专业级产出。我后来尝试描述更复杂的物流轨迹跟踪系统AI也能准确理解运单-驿站-配送员之间的网状关系。唯一需要注意的是复杂业务最好分模块描述比如先描述用户模块再描述订单模块最后说明关联关系这样生成的ER图会更清晰。

更多文章